The adsorption strength of a catalyst determines how tightly reactant molecules can bind to its surface, influencing the efficiency and speed of chemical reactions. Strong adsorption can enhance catalytic activity by facilitating reactant binding and reducing the energy required for reactions to proceed. However, if adsorption is too strong, it may hinder product desorption and deactivate the catalyst over time.

What is the most important factor in determining the strength of an oxyacid?

The most important factor in determining the strength of an oxyacid is the polarity and strength of the O-H bond. The more polar and weaker the O-H bond, the stronger the oxyacid will be. Additionally, the presence of more electronegative atoms surrounding the central atom can also increase the acidity of the oxyacid.
